Gettin’ bugged: Return of the love bugs can damage car’s paint job
Hordes of love bugs have begun making a return threat to car paint jobs in East Texas.
Carwashes and driveways have become war zones as the fight begins to remove the coating of squashed bug bodies from bumpers, headlights and hoods. Leaving the bugs on your car’s paint too long can cause damage, according to Dr. Paul Risk, professor emeritus in the College of Forestry at Stephen F. Austin State University.
